## Understand GEO fundamentals

In addition to learned knowledge, AI uses web pages and other resources it retrieves on the fly to answer questions. The foundation of GEO is publishing official pages that clearly state product name, features, pricing, supported environments, and usage instructions so they directly answer user questions.

### 1. Audit visibility in AI search

Start with questions your target users would ask AI and investigate how the answers present your product and its competitors. Include both unbranded selection questions and product-specific questions about setup, use, and troubleshooting.

| Question stage    | Example questions                              | What to check                                       |
| ----------------- | ---------------------------------------------- | --------------------------------------------------- |
| Problem awareness | Ways to speed up work, causes of errors        | Is your product category described as a solution?   |
| Finding a product | Tools for a specific purpose, recommended apps | Is your product introduced as a candidate?          |
| Comparing         | Alternatives, pricing, feature differences     | Are facts correct and reasons for comparison shown? |
| Getting started   | How to sign up, integrate, initial setup       | Are official steps cited?                           |
| Troubleshooting   | Can't configure, how to handle errors          | Is help that matches current specifications cited?  |

Main metrics to check are <Tooltip tip="Shows how much your company is mentioned in AI answers relative to competitors. Abbreviation for Share of Voice.">**SOV**</Tooltip>, which indicates your mention share compared to competitors in AI answers, and <Tooltip tip="Shows the share of AI-cited sources that are your site. Abbreviation for AI Citation Share.">**ACS**</Tooltip>, which indicates the proportion of cited sources that come from your site. In addition to numbers, verify answer accuracy and the cited pages.

The same question can yield different answers depending on environment, pricing plan, device, and permissions. Narrow to conditions your product actually supports, and save the question, check date, answer, and cited sources. After improvements, compare under the same conditions.

### 2. Make product information easy for AI systems to access and cite

Make pages retrievable and understandable so AI can identify product information. Reviewing the table from top to bottom helps isolate issues with access to important pages, problems with AI reading product information, and inconsistencies across multiple pages.

| What to prepare for correct AI referencing | Check on public pages and take action if there are issues                                                                                                                                                               |
| ------------------------------------------ | ----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- |
| Fetching                                   | Ensure <Tooltip tip="Programs that automatically fetch web pages for search engines and AI services.">**crawlers**</Tooltip> are not blocked by robots.txt or delivery settings, and publish important pages over HTTPS |
| Discovery                                  | Make sure users can reach features, pricing, comparisons, use cases, articles, documentation, and help from the homepage; fix internal links and sitemap.xml                                                            |
| Understanding                              | Present product name, target users, features, pricing, supported environments, and usage instructions in the HTML body and add structured data that matches the UI                                                      |
| Accuracy                                   | Align names, pricing, specs, and update dates across official pages, articles, and docs; update or remove outdated info                                                                                                 |
| Evidence                                   | Clarify company, authors, verification methods, usage data, case studies, and information sources                                                                                                                       |

If you want your published info included in ChatGPT search results, also confirm you are not blocking OAI-SearchBot from fetching your pages.

### 3. Create content for product evaluation and use

For questions lacking clear answers in your visibility audit, publish pages that clearly answer them with official information. Choose the page type based on the question’s purpose.

| Content                            | Main role                                                                                 |
| ---------------------------------- | ----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- |
| Feature, pricing, comparison pages | Accurately show target users, capabilities, pricing, and differences                      |
| Use cases and templates            | Show which tasks the product is used for and how it is used                               |
| Documentation and help             | Show sign-up, setup, integrations, specs, limits, and error handling                      |
| Articles and FAQ                   | Answer selection and usage questions and common questions with conclusions first          |
| Research and case studies          | Provide original data, test results, and user outcomes with supporting evidence           |
| Video                              | Demonstrate operations and results to supplement steps that are hard to explain with text |

Ensure features, pricing, and procedures match the current product. Do not publish unverified effects or comparisons; include timeframes and conditions with any numeric claims.

On pages aimed at product selection, show target users, use cases, pricing, supported environments, and comparison criteria. On pages for current users, clearly state required plans, permissions, operating systems, versions, and the expected result after each procedure. Remove outdated screens or specifications and show the last-updated date.

### 4. Monitor and improve visibility over time

Regularly re-run the same questions to track changes in answers, mentions, and cited sources. Assess changes and responses together.

| What AI answers show                                     | Possible cause and response                                                                                                                                                                                                             |
| -------------------------------------------------------- | --------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- |
| Your product is not presented as a candidate             | The question may not fit the product, or public pages may not explain the relevant use case and requirements. Confirm product fit, then improve or create a use-case, comparison, or category page that answers the question directly.  |
| Competitors appear and receive citations, but you do not | Inspect the cited competitor pages for the features, evidence, pricing, or compatibility details used in the answer. Add missing first-party information to the most relevant official page without imitating the competitor’s wording. |
| Features, limits, or pricing are incorrect               | Public sources may conflict or remain outdated after a product change. Update the product site, pricing page, documentation, release notes, and store listing, then standardize terminology across them.                                |
| Instructions in the answer no longer match the product   | Help pages or videos may show an older interface or omit a prerequisite. Reproduce the task in the current product, update screens and steps, and explain permissions, failure recovery, and version-specific limitations.              |
| The product is mentioned without a citation              | AI systems may recognize the product but lack an authoritative page supporting the claim. Publish concrete specifications, tested workflows, methodology, and primary information in accessible HTML.                                   |

Don’t focus only on low numeric scores; verify business impact and answer accuracy. Choose questions to improve and compare the cited sources with your pages in the next step.

Do not prioritize questions for uses or environments your product does not support. Prioritize fixing questions where pricing, supported environments, key features, or usage are incorrectly described even if mention counts are low.

Fix important pages that can’t be fetched and pages where features, pricing, or usage are unclear or outdated. For sites managed with NoimosAI, make fixes in the same chat, preview, and then publish. For new or updated pages, check index status in Google Search Console.

Audit results commonly find important info hidden behind login, specification mismatches between product pages and help, and lingering old URLs. After fixes, connect product, pricing, features, help, and update info with internal links.
